The Advanced Practice Provider will be responsible for comprehensive direct patient care management and will manage a caseload of patients by exercising autonomous decision making in the assessment, diagnosis, and initiation of delegated medical treatments. The APP will provide healthcare and patient services that may include education, research, and clinical support, as well as complete administrative activities under the direction and supervision of the Director/leadership. The APP has acquired the knowledge, skills, and judgment necessary to assist the physician through organized instruction and supervised practice.
The Care Transitions Clinic (CTC) APP will perform in-person and tele-health ambulatory care visits for a variety of patient populations with both acute and chronic needs and in-patient chronic disease hospital consults. A broad experience base of Primary Care, Urgent Care, Oncology and/or a variety of experience in several Medical Specialties will be helpful for the person in this role. All programs and services of the Care Transitions Clinic are aimed at reducing Emergency Department utilization, hospital admissions, and re-admissions.
